Lando Norris has warned Method 1 chiefs that they danger making racing “boring” if drivers proceed to be punished for working large after making errors within the struggle for place.
Virtually misplaced amid the frenzy surrounding Norris’s collision with Max Verstappen in Austria final weekend was the truth that the McLaren driver had picked up a five-second penalty for working large after a botched move on his Crimson Bull rival a number of laps earlier than.

Having already been pinged for 3 monitor limits breaches earlier within the race, Norris locking up and taking to the run-off at Flip 3 was deemed sufficient to earn him a five-second penalty.

It’s a state of affairs the place Norris thinks some frequent sense must be utilized if drivers aren’t going to be deterred from making an attempt overtakes.

“It’s fairly foolish, to be sincere,” mentioned Norris in regards to the monitor limits state of affairs. “I’ve tried to do an overtake, I’ve locked up, I’ve gone off the monitor simply, and tried then to keep away from the sausage kerb.

“Then instantly I gave the place again to Max, so I most likely misplaced a second and a half in doing that. It is clearly not a penalty. I’ve misplaced out in doing such a factor.

“These types of issues will keep away from individuals racing. If you don’t need us to race and don’t need me to attempt to overtake and have a boring race, then you’ll be able to have these guidelines.”

With the monitor limits situation prone to be mentioned within the numerous group managers and drivers’ conferences at Silverstone this weekend, Norris hoped that there was sufficient consensus for the principles to be modified.

“I am positive it is one thing that has already been introduced up as a result of there is a distinction between going off monitor and gaining a bonus and going off since you’ve made a foolish mistake and you have not judged one thing completely.

“The actual fact you get punished for that, particularly in a racing state of affairs, particularly when I’ve given up much more time, it simply does not make sense. So, it’s one thing I hope they repair shortly.”

Norris has discovered some allies within the opinion that getting a monitor limits penalty for making a mistake whereas battling for place isn’t proper.

RB’s Yuki Tsunoda mentioned he was picked up for the same infringement on the Spanish GP, which left him massively irritated on the time.

The Japanese mentioned: “In Barcelona, I feel I went large at Flip 1 and since I used to be battling with one other automobile and compelled large. Clearly, I took the best [escape] highway to rejoin to the monitor subsequent to the bollard and I adopted the principles, however they took it as a monitor limits [penalty].

“I imply, I did not acquire something. Clearly, I let the automobile move and in the long run, I rejoined the automobile behind. I had two events [already and] they counted that as monitor limits.

Policing clarification

The Norris penalty in Austria was not the one monitor limits controversy, together with his team-mate Oscar Piastri nonetheless remaining sad about sure facets of him dropping his greatest lap from qualifying after being deemed to have run large at Flip 6.

Whereas there are not any grounds to go over that particular incident anymore with the FIA, the Australian thinks there are points that want addressing for the long run.

“I feel for me there’s two factors,” he mentioned. “I feel the primary one is that if there may be house for a automobile to go off, that we monitor it in a good approach.

“The proof that led to my lap being deleted was from a helicopter that was solely on me for that lap, which is a bit painful when there are different those who probably additionally went off that did not have a helicopter on them. So, I feel it is a very wonderful line

“Then there are some discussions we have to have [about solutions], however the best solution to eliminate that’s make the white line 20cm wider and never have to fret about it in any respect.”
